About Psychosocial Recovery Coaching in Melbourne - Outer East

Find Psychosocial Recovery Coaching NDIS providers in Melbourne - Outer East, Victoria supporting mental health participants to build independence and community connections.

56 providers offer Psychosocial Recovery Coaching supports to NDIS participants in Melbourne - Outer East, Victoria. 38 of them are registered with the NDIS Quality and Safeguards Commission. You First is currently the highest rated at 5.0 stars from 28 reviews. Support in Melbourne - Outer East is delivered as home and community visits, in centre, in group sessions, online and via telehealth. Local Psychosocial Recovery Coaching services cover all ages, with support available in 33 languages beyond English.
